What La Privada at Scottsdale Ranch Condominium's governing documents say
La Privada at Scottsdale Ranch is a condominium community in Phoenix, AZ — you own the interior of your unit, while the association maintains the common elements and limited common elements (e.g., parking spaces, patios). The community is part of a master-planned development (Scottsdale Ranch) with an additional master association that enforces architectural control and collects separate assessments.
- What you own & maintain: You own the finished surfaces (walls, floors, ceilings, etc.) inside your unit. Structural elements, common areas, and limited common elements (like your designated parking space, patio, and building utilities) are owned by the association, which maintains them.
- Assessments & fees: Unit owners pay annual assessments and may be charged special assessments for capital improvements or unexpected repairs. Assessments are a personal obligation and create a lien on the unit if unpaid. A reserve fund is required, and an initial working capital fund may be collected.
- Parking & vehicles: Each unit is entitled to one covered parking space (a limited common element). Additional spaces can be purchased (subject to availability). Parking is only for 'Permitted Vehicles' — passenger cars and similar; commercial vehicles, boats, and trailers are generally prohibited.
- Leasing & rentals: Leasing is allowed, but the exact restrictions (e.g., minimum lease term) are not detailed in this excerpt. If you lease your unit, the tenant (and their family) may use the common elements during the lease term, while you lose that right until the lease ends.
- Architectural review: Exterior modifications (e.g., windows, antennas, roof equipment) require approval from an Architectural Committee or the Board. The committee sets design guidelines and may grant variances.
- Pets: The declaration mentions 'Animals' in the use restrictions but does not specify limits or types in this excerpt. Pets are likely subject to association rules.
- Clubhouse & common amenities: The clubhouse and recreational facilities are common elements. The developer reserves a license to use part of the clubhouse for sales and management offices. Owners and their tenants may use the common amenities, subject to association rules and fees.
- Master association: La Privada is part of Scottsdale Ranch, which has its own master association with architectural control and separate assessments. If there is a conflict between the condominium and master rules, the stricter rule applies.
Key facts from La Privada at Scottsdale Ranch Condominium's documents
- Community type
- Condominium (Title and Article I definitions)
- Legal name
- La Privada Condominium Association, Inc. (Section 1.06)
- Units / lots
- Not explicitly stated in extracted text (Not available)
- Developer / declarant
- La Privada Development LLC, a Delaware limited liability company (Background paragraph A and Section 1.17)
- Governing law
- Arizona Condominium Act (A.R.S. §§ 33-1201 through 33-1270) (Section 1.01)
- Assessments & dues
- Determined annually by Board of Directors; initial assessment set by Board. (Section 4.03)
- Special assessments
- May be levied for capital improvements, unexpected repairs, or other extraordinary expenses; requires approval by 51% of eligible votes cast at a meeting with quorum. (Section 4.04)
- Collections & liens
- Unpaid assessments constitute a consensual and continuing lien on the Unit; Association may foreclose in same manner as mortgage; lien subordinate to first mortgage except for assessments accruing after mortgagee acquires title. (Sections 4.01, 4.07, 4.08)
- Reserves & fees
- Reserve Account established; initial Reserve Contribution of two monthly Assessment installments from purchasers (with exceptions); funds to be used only for future periodic maintenance, repair, replacement of Common Elements; separate bank (Section 4.11 (a) through (f))

- Parking & vehicles
- Each Unit entitled to one covered Unit Parking Space (Limited Common Element). Additional Designated Spaces may be purchased (license) on as-available basis. Open Parking Spaces available on first come, first served basis. (Section 2.07 (b), (c), (d), (e))
- Architectural approval
- Yes, for exterior modifications; Architectural Committee reviews; Board can serve as committee (Section 7.01, Section 7.02)

- Maintenance
- Association maintains Common Elements (Section 5.01); Owner maintains Unit (Section 5.03); Association may repair owner's failure at owner's expense (Section 5.04) (Sections 5.01, 5.03, 5.04)

- Voting & meetings
- Class A: one vote per Unit owned (excluding Declarant). Class B: Declarant casts three votes per Unit owned until conversion. (Section 3.02 (a) and (b))
